How to teach a parrot to dance

How to teach a parrot to dance
Parrots are very smart animals. They have the amazing ability to mimic human speech, and can also copy actions. This is how to use their mimicry skills to teach them how to dance.

Step 1Before you start

1. The parrot or parrots you wish to teach must be comfortable with you. Parrots tend to attach themselves to one person and if you aren't that person then there isn't much point trying.

2. Parrots have short attention spans. This means that they will benefit more from two 10 minute sessions than one 20 minute session. If your bird doesn't want to play, it wont even attempt to learn.

3. Be prepared to look like a complete idiot. In order for your bird to learn, you must do the actions. This means a lot of bad dance moves and some odd stares if you're not alone or your curtains are open!
